Essential Duties And Responsibilities

Core duties and responsibilities include the following. Other duties may be assigned.

  • Trains and relieves machine operators as needed
  • Fills in for the Lead during their absence, including performing color changes, quality checks, and become familiar with mold changeovers
  • Reads work order or follows oral instructions to ascertain materials or containers to be moved
  • Counts, weighs, and records number of units of materials moved or handled on daily production sheet
  • Lifts heavy objects by hand or with power hoist, and cleans work area, machines, and equipment to assist machine operators
  • Dumps by hand materials such as colors or plastic, into machine hoppers or move product by hand onto scrap pallets
  • Operates industrial truck or electric hoist to assist in loading or moving materials and products
  • Reads spread sheets to determine specific material requirements at changeovers
  • Performs necessary maintenance and repair on some equipment used
  • Responsible for performing the physical tasks involved in the shipping, receiving, storing, and distributing of products, materials, parts, supplies and equipment
  • Prepares and maintains records of product movement
  • Pulls raw materials and finish product from various locations for manufacturing orders
Physical Demands

The physical demands described here are representative of those that must be met by an employee to successfully perform the essential functions of this job. Reasonable accommodations may be made to enable individuals with disabilities to perform the essential functions.

While performing the duties of this job, the employee is regularly required to stand; walk; use hands to finger, handle, or feel; reach with hands and arms; and talk or hear. The employee is occasionally required to sit, climb or balance, stoop, kneel, crouch, or crawl, and taste or smell.

The employee must regularly lift and /or move up to 10 pounds, frequently lift and/or move up to 40 pounds, and occasionally lift and/or move up to 50 pounds.

Work Environment

The work environment characteristics described here are representative of those an employee encounters while performing the essential functions of this job.

While performing the duties of this job, the employee is regularly exposed to moving mechanical parts. The employee is occasionally exposed to wet and/or humid conditions; high, precarious places

The noise level in the work environment is usually loud.
